1. What characteristics does a scientific hypothesis have? Select the TWO answers that are correct. A) The hypothesis is something that can be tested. B) The hypothesis contains a supernatural element. C) The hypothesis could be proven false. D) The hypothesis is based on an opinion. E) The hypothesis has already been proven correct. 2. Which example describes the set-up of a controlled experiment? A) Ten subjects receive a new drug and another ten subjects receive a sugar pill. B) Twenty subjects with knee pain receive the same treatment to relieve joint pain. C) A doctor treats one subject for a disease and observes how quickly the patient recovers. D) Researchers collect lifestyle data from fifty questionnaires submitted by subjects with the same disease. E) Fifteen subjects with the common cold take a cold medicine and answer questions about its effects. 1. A, C 2. A
